Discover which therapies are expected to grab the NETs market share @ Neuroendocrine Tumors Market Report Neuroendocrine Tumors Overview Neuroendocrine Tumors (NETs) are a diverse group of cancers that arise from neuroendocrine cells, which have characteristics of both nerve cells and hormone-producing cells. These tumors can develop anywhere in the body but are most commonly found in the gastrointestinal tract, pancreas, and lungs. The exact causes of neuroendocrine tumors are not fully understood, but certain factors may increase risk, including genetic syndromes like multiple endocrine neoplasia type 1 (MEN1), Von Hippel-Lindau disease, and neurofibromatosis. Other potential contributors include chronic inflammatory conditions, smoking, and exposure to certain chemicals. Symptoms of NETs can vary widely depending on the tumor's location and whether it secretes hormones. Some tumors may be asymptomatic for a long time. Common symptoms include abdominal pain, diarrhea, flushing of the skin, unexplained weight loss, and in cases of hormone-secreting tumors, symptoms related to excess hormones, such as changes in blood sugar levels or high blood pressure. Diagnosing NETs typically involves a combination of blood and urine tests to detect hormone levels, imaging studies like CT, MRI, or PET scans, and biopsies to analyze tumor tissue. Specialized tests like chromogranin A (CgA) blood tests or somatostatin receptor scintigraphy (Octreoscan) may also be used to identify neuroendocrine activity and locate tumors. The frontline treatment for metastatic disease is somatostatin analogs, and currently, two agents are FDA-approved: SANDOSTATIN (octreotide acetate) and SOMATULINE DEPOT (lanreotide). Both somatostatin analogs provide symptomatic relief in 50% to 70% of patients and biochemical responses in 40% to 60% of patients. Traditionally, mTOR inhibitor – everolimus or sunitinib – was acknowledged as a second-line agent, but with the recent approval of PRRT (peptide receptor radionuclide therapy), the choice of second-line therapy is debatable. While GEP-NETs in children and adolescents are rare, the impact can be devastating. Advanced Accelerator Applications (AAA)/Novartis's LUTATHERA is now the very first therapy approved specifically for use in pediatric patients with GEP-NETs. offering new hope to young patients living with this rare cancer. In January 2018, the FDA approved LUTATHERA, a radiolabeled somatostatin analog for the treatment of GEP-NETs. In April 2024, Novartis announced that the US FDA approved LUTATHERA for the treatment of pediatric patients 12 years and older with SSTR+ GEP-NETs, including foregut, midgut, and hindgut NETs. LUTATHERA is also approved in Europe for unresectable or metastatic, progressive, well-differentiated (G1 and G2), SSTR-positive GEP-NETs in adults, and in Japan for SSTR-positive NETs. CABOMETYX (cabozantinib) is a small-molecule inhibitor targeting several receptor tyrosine kinases, such as VEGFRs, MET, RET, and the TAM family (TYRO3, MER, AXL). In August 2024, the FDA accepted a supplemental New Drug Application (sNDA) for cabozantinib to treat patients with advanced pancreatic neuroendocrine tumors (pNET) and extra-pancreatic neuroendocrine tumors (epNET) who have previously undergone treatment. The FDA set a PDUFA target date of April 3, 2025, for review and granted orphan drug designation for pNET. This application is supported by data from the Phase III CABINET trial, which studied CABOMETYX in these patient populations. ITM-11 (177Lu-edotreotide) , developed by ITM Isotope Technologies Munich , is a novel Targeted Radionuclide Therapy that combines two components: Edotreotide (DOTATOC), an octreotide-based somatostatin analog, and EndolucinBeta (n.c.a. lutetium-177 chloride), a low-energy beta-emitting synthetic radioisotope. It is currently under investigation in two Phase III clinical trials: COMPETE (NCT03049189) and COMPOSE (NCT04919226). COMPETE focuses on assessing ITM-11 for treating Grade 1 and Grade 2 GEP-NETs, while COMPOSE investigates its use in patients with well-differentiated high Grade 2 and Grade 3 GEP-NETs. ITM-11 was granted orphan designation for GEP-NET treatment based on Phase II data showing significant improvement in PFS. How to stretch your Turkey Day dollar and turn leftovers into easy, creative meals you’ve never heard ofUS President-elect Donald Trump filed a brief Friday urging the Supreme Court to pause a law that would ban TikTok the day before his January 20 inauguration if it is not sold by its Chinese owner ByteDance. "In light of the novelty and difficulty of this case, the court should consider staying the statutory deadline to grant more breathing space to address these issues," Trump's legal team wrote, to give him "the opportunity to pursue a political resolution." Trump was fiercely opposed to TikTok during his 2017-21 first term, and tried in vain to ban the video app on national security grounds. The Republican voiced concerns - echoed by political rivals - that the Chinese government might tap into US TikTok users' data or manipulate what they see on the platform. US officials had also voiced alarm over the popularity of the video-sharing app with young people, alleging that its parent company is subservient to Beijing and that the app is used to spread propaganda, claims denied by the company and the Chinese government. Trump called for a US company to buy TikTok, with the government sharing in the sale price, and his successor Joe Biden went one stage further - signing a law to ban the app for the same reasons. Trump has now, however, reversed course. At a press conference last week, Trump said he has "a warm spot" for TikTok and that his administration would take a look at the app and the potential ban. Earlier this month, the president-elect met with TikTok CEO Shou Zi Chew at his Mar-a-Lago residence in Florida. Recently, Trump told Bloomberg he had changed his mind about the app: "Now (that) I'm thinking about it, I'm for TikTok, because you need competition." "If you don't have TikTok, you have Facebook and Instagram - and that's, you know, that's Zuckerberg." A mealworm breeding tray [ https://www.agriculture-solution.com/products/ ] is a specialized insect breeding tray designed to create the best environment for mealworms to grow and reproduce. These trays are carefully designed to provide the necessary conditions for mealworms to reproduce, including proper temperature, humidity and space for movement. The tray is designed to easily monitor and manage the breeding process, making it an essential tool for anyone interested in insect farming. Image: https://www.agriculture-solution.com/uploads/%E6%98%86%E8%99%AB%E6%A1%86%E8%AF%A6%E6%83%85_012.jpg Main features of insect breeding tray Materials and Durability: Made from high-quality, non-toxic materials to ensure insect safety, these trays are designed to withstand the rigors of enclosure, including humidity and temperature fluctuations. Ventilation: Proper airflow is vital to insect health. The insect breeding tray is equipped with ventilation holes to ensure adequate air circulation, prevent the accumulation of harmful gases, and ensure a healthy environment for insects. Modular Design: Many mealworm feeding trays feature a modular design, allowing users to stack multiple trays. This maximizes space efficiency and enables keepers to manage different life stages of mealworms simultaneously. Easy to Clean: Hygiene is crucial in insect farming. The tray is designed for easy cleaning and has a smooth surface that prevents the build-up of waste and bacteria. This function is essential for maintaining a healthy breeding environment. Temperature Regulation: Some advanced mealworm breeding trays have built-in temperature regulation systems. This feature is particularly beneficial to keepers in areas with extreme temperatures, ensuring that mealworms are kept within the ideal temperature range for optimal growth.
